What is the significance of Juliet's diction in this section of the play?
Juliet feels her Nurse is more honorable than Romeo.
Juliet believes Romeo has brought shame to their life.
Juliet defends Romeo by describing him as honorable.
Juliet blames herself for the death of her cousin Tybalt.

Answers

C because she loves him

Answer:

A) Juliet feels her Nurse is more honorable than Romeo.

Explanation:

Hope I'm right!

May someone plz help me summarise Act 5 Scene 3 of Romeo and Juliet.

I will give you brainliest

Answers

Answer:

In the churchyard that night, Paris enters with a torch-bearing servant. He orders the page to withdraw, then begins scattering flowers on Juliet’s grave. He hears a whistle—the servant’s warning that someone is approaching. He withdraws into the darkness. Romeo, carrying a crowbar, enters with Balthasar. He tells Balthasar that he has come to open the Capulet tomb in order to take back a valuable ring he had given to Juliet. Then he orders Balthasar to leave, and, in the morning, to deliver to Montague the letter Romeo had given him. Balthasar withdraws, but, mistrusting his master’s intentions, lingers to watch.  

From his hiding place, Paris recognizes Romeo as the man who murdered Tybalt, and thus as the man who indirectly murdered Juliet, since it is her grief for her cousin that is supposed to have killed her. As Romeo has been exiled from the city on penalty of death, Paris thinks that Romeo must hate the Capulets so much that he has returned to the tomb to do some dishonor to the corpse of either Tybalt or Juliet. In a rage, Paris accosts Romeo. Romeo pleads with him to leave, but Paris refuses. They draw their swords and fight. Paris’s page runs off to get the civil watch. Romeo kills Paris. As he dies, Paris asks to be laid near Juliet in the tomb, and Romeo consents.

Explanation:

Choose the correctly punctuated sentence. On the display screen, was a soothing pattern of light and shadow. After the morning rains cease, the swimmers emerge from their cottages. Some first-year architecture students, expect to design intricate structures immediately. Shade-loving plants such as, begonias, impatiens, and coleus can add color to a shady garden.

Answers

Answer:

The sentence that is correctly punctuated is:

After the morning rains cease, the swimmers emerge from their cottages.

Explanation:

Let's look at each sentence individually to find the problems.

1. On the display screen, was a soothing pattern of light and shadow. --> The comma is separating the subject and the verb, which should never be done. This sentence is INCORRECT.

2. After the morning rains cease, the swimmers emerge from their cottages. --> This sentence is CORRECT. The comma is separating the ideas expressed in the different clauses.

3. Some first-year architecture students, expect to design intricate structures immediately. --> Again, we have a comma separating the subject and the verb. This is INCORRECT

4. Shade-loving plants such as, begonias, impatiens, and coleus can add color to a shady garden. --> When using "such as", we should not place a comma right before the first item to be listed. Therefore, there shouldn't be a comma before "begonias". This is INCORRECT

while a _______ is a group of closely related phenomena or observations, _______ is a logical idea that can be tested.

Answers

While a theory is a group of closely related phenomena or observations, the hypothesis is a logical idea that can be tested.

A theory is a supported and widely accepted explanation for an individual or collection of connected natural phenomena. Theories, which typically contain a sizable body of supporting evidence, have been tested and confirmed using a variety of experiments and observations.

Whereas, a hypothesis, is generally a speculative explanation or a forecast regarding a specific phenomenon that can be verified by study. A hypothesis is used to direct study and testing and is typically based on observations or prior information. If the research's findings confirm the hypothesis, it may be changed or deleted; however, if the findings contradict the hypothesis, it may be included in a broader theory.
